    Zac Clark has opened up on how his relationship with Tayshia Adams has not always been that rosy. 

    ‘The Bachelorette’: Zac Clark Opens Up On His Relationship Difficulties With Tayshia Adams

    The duo have continuously had to deny rumours that they had split. And as for Zac, he could understand why people would behave that way. In an interview with Us Weekly, he said: “Naturally, it’s for all the reasons that people say it shouldn’t work. Because it’s so quick and all that stuff. And I hear that. There’s also a lot of reasons why, for me, it does work.”

    But in fact, their relationship has only become stronger. Zac has gotten over his substance abuse issues, and Tayshia is doing well in her own right. The latter is taking over Chris Harrison’s role on The Bachelorette, and the fans have really taken to her. Zac has been there throughout that journey, as he was seen on set supporting Tayshia during the filming.

    It seems the couple have learnt to support each other. He added: “Cause you put the cell phone down, there’s no distractions, your conversations are very, like, pointed and structured and you really give yourself — like, for me, I gave myself that opportunity to kind of really explore what love was and what this relationship could be.”

    The rumours that had blighted the couple went to a whole new level, though. Speculation was rife that the duo had split after Tayshia was spotted without her ring. Naturally, rather than wait for an explanation, fans spiralled out of control and assumed the worst. And yet, it was something simpler as Tayshia was merely getting her ring adjusted. For Zac, he has learned to take the rough with the smooth.

    He continued: “And at the end of the day, none of that other stuff really, truly matters. I think you need to be aware, and I think you need to acknowledge that it could be difficult … but no, that’s why we have each other to support us through those difficult times.” It is great to see Zac in a much better place.

    He has come a long way since his addiction, and let us hope that this can continue into the future.
